  • Page 3 Fixed (ECL, ECL, TTL) Pulses Delay Pulse levels for 5On loading as shown: Pulse occurrence can be delayed from less than 10 ns to 100 ms with respect to the sync pulse. Maximum duty cycle is 70% for periods to 200 ns, decreasing to 30% for 20 ns periods.
